Hello, I’m John, a retired precision  engineer from Newcastle Upon Tyne.

 

I am a Motability customer, and on Saturday I have just ordered a new Skoda Yeti SEL, my first Skoda car, but definitely not the last!  The quality of build is superb, as is the comfort. 

 

The dealer in Cramlington arranged for me to have the test drive for a full day, which was great, and much better than the usual ‘round the block’ test drive. I’ve driven and  owned a lot of different cars in my time, but the new Yeti is absolutely superb for my needs.

 

The only disappointment I had when I ordered the Yeti SEL, was to be told that the factory option of ‘Boreal Wood’ inserts   (which was in the brochure at £65) is  no longer available!  I know it’s a personal thing, some don’t like it, but I do, and I was very disappointed to be told it has been taken off the list of options.

 

I am looking forward to driving my Yeti, which should arrive in April.

Welcome John!  Yes, its a shame about the wood inserts that seem to be disappearing generally across the range.  They are considered more old style and the metal and brushed aluminium look is more in vogue now.  I like the wood effect personally.  You can always get aftermarket wood inserts on one of the sites like superskoda.com or have the inserts wrapped in a colour of your choice.  Best of luck with the Yeti!

If anybody is interested, I have finally been  told that any Skoda dealer CAN order the Boreal wood inserts for the Yeti as ‘spare parts’, and they cost £119inc VAT supplied as parts, or  £264inc VAT supplied and fitted.
